Item 8.01                                             Other Events.

 

As previously disclosed, pursuant to a proposal included in Tyco International Ltd.’s (the “Company”) proxy statement for its annual general meeting of shareholders held on March 10, 2010, shareholders approved a dividend in the form of a capital reduction equal to 0.90 Swiss francs (CHF) per share payable in four quarterly installments through the end of the second fiscal quarter of 2011. The third installment of the distribution, equal to CHF 0.23 per share, was paid to shareholder on or about November 23, 2010.  The US dollar amount of the dividend payment was $0.2307 per share, based on the USD/CHF exchange rate in effect on November 16, 2010 of 0.9968.

 

In connection with the payment of this distribution, the Company amended its Articles of Association to reflect the reduction in par value of CHF 0.23 per share, effective upon their filing with the commercial register of the Canton of Schaffhausen, Switzerland.  As a result, the par value of each share of the Company is now CHF 6.93.

 

A copy of the amended Articles of Association is attached hereto as Exhibit 3.1 and incorporated herein by reference.
